- What is this tool?
- Describely automates SEO-optimized product description generation from catalog data for retailers and agencies.
- How much does it cost?
- Describely offers a free plan and paid subscriptions starting at $20 per month.
- Does it have a free plan?
- Yes, there is a free plan with basic features and limited bulk imports.
- What integrations does it support?
- No public integrations or API are currently available.
- Who is it best for?
- It is best for retailers, brands, and agencies needing bulk SEO product description automation.
- What is this tool?
- Topic is a content strategy tool that analyzes top-performing content to help marketers create effective strategies.
- How much does it cost?
- Topic offers a free plan and paid subscriptions starting at $20 per month.
- Does it have a free plan?
- Yes, Topic provides a free plan with limited features suitable for individuals.
- What integrations does it support?
- Topic does not currently offer public API or third-party integrations.
- Who is it best for?
- It is best suited for marketers and content creators focused on data-driven content strategy.

Topic has an overall score of 5.5/10 and offers a freemium pricing model, providing basic features for free with options to upgrade for additional functionality. Describely scores slightly lower at 5.4/10 and also uses a freemium pricing structure, focusing on content generation and writing assistance. While both tools share similar pricing approaches, Topic tends to emphasize content organization and topic research, whereas Describely is more centered on enhancing writing quality and style.
